Cryptocurrency investments typically involve a combination of trading fees, withdrawal charges, and sometimes even hidden costs like spreads. Here’s a breakdown of the key fees to look for when comparing popular crypto investment apps in the United States.

Common Fee Types

  • Trading Fees: These are the most common fees associated with buying and selling cryptocurrencies. They are typically calculated as a percentage of the trade value.
  • Withdrawal Fees: Some platforms charge a fee for transferring crypto to an external wallet, which can vary based on network congestion.
  • Deposit Fees: While many apps allow free deposits via bank transfers, some platforms charge when funding accounts with credit cards or other payment methods.

How Robo-Advisors Use AI in Crypto Investment

The role of AI in these apps is to analyze massive amounts of data and predict trends. The software learns from previous trading patterns and market behavior, continuously improving its accuracy. For crypto traders, this means reduced emotional decision-making, faster reactions to market changes, and potentially more informed strategies.

Features of Tax-Efficient Crypto Investment Apps

  • Automatic Tax Calculation: These apps can calculate your capital gains, losses, and other taxable events based on your transactions.
  • Tax-Loss Harvesting: Some apps help you strategically sell assets that have lost value to offset gains from other investments.
  • Real-Time Tax Tracking: Many apps offer real-time tracking of your crypto portfolio, helping you stay on top of tax events as they occur.
  • Integration with Tax Filing Software: The best apps integrate directly with tax filing software, making the tax filing process seamless.

Tax Strategies for Crypto Investors

  1. Long-Term Holding: Hold crypto assets for over a year to benefit from lower long-term capital gains rates.
  2. Staking Rewards: If you earn crypto through staking, ensure that you understand how those rewards are taxed as income.
  3. Consider Tax-Advantaged Accounts: Some investors choose to hold crypto in tax-advantaged accounts, like IRAs, to defer or avoid taxes on their gains.

Security Features of Major U.S. Investment Apps

  • Two-Factor Authentication (2FA): Most platforms require 2FA for account access, adding an extra layer of protection by requiring users to verify their identity through a second method, such as a text message or authentication app.
  • Cold Storage for Cryptocurrency: Leading apps store a significant portion of users' digital assets in offline, "cold" wallets, reducing the risk of hacking and online theft.
  • Insurance Coverage: Some platforms provide insurance for digital assets stored on the platform, ensuring that users are compensated in case of a breach or loss due to hacking incidents.

Security Vulnerabilities to Be Aware Of

  1. Phishing Attacks: Fraudsters may try to trick you into revealing your login credentials by posing as the app’s official support team.
  2. Platform Hacking: Even with top-tier security, investment apps can still be targeted by hackers seeking to exploit vulnerabilities.
  3. Regulatory Uncertainty: The lack of clear regulations surrounding cryptocurrency investments can lead to uncertainties regarding consumer protection.
